This is a tough question because the answer depends on when and where. If you are just worried about who was there first, then the answer should be the Franciscans who worked from 1526 [when the pope declared the Native American Indian capable of understanding Catholicism] to about 1573 which is when hundred of missions were present in Florida and New Mexico.
Later on California had 21 missions along the El Camino Real (from San Francisco to San Diego).

The protests for democratic reformation of China in the Tiananmen square where not seen fondly by the Chinese government. They decided to use military force in order to destroy the protest, and it was not just to move the people away or scare them off, but it was very brutal. Lot of people that were protesting were actually killed the by the military, and that was supposed to serve as an example for any other people in the country that would try and do something like that.
The protest was dominated by young people, students in general, and unfortunately, their will for better and free life meant death for lot of them.
